域名怎么映射端口

域名出售,求购欢迎联系QQ:1082484

域名怎么映射端口

域名怎么映射端口

域名映射端口是指将域名与服务器的特定端口进行关联,使得通过该域名可以访问到服务器上运行的特定服务。

在进行域名映射端口之前,需要先购买一个域名并配置DNS解析。DNS解析将域名转换为对应的IP地址,使得可以通过域名访问到服务器。

一般情况下,域名默认使用80端口进行访问,也就是说当我们通过域名访问服务器时,默认会连接到该服务器的80端口。
但有些情况下,我们希望通过不同的域名访问到服务器的不同服务,这时就需要进行端口映射。

端口映射可以通过在服务器上配置反向代理实现。常用的反向代理服务器包括Nginx和Apache等。
通过配置反向代理,我们可以将不同域名映射到不同的端口上。

以Nginx为例,我们可以通过以下配置实现域名映射端口:

server {
    listen 80;
    server_name www.example.com;

    location / {
        proxy_pass http://localhost:8080;
    }
}

上述配置中,监听端口为80,当访问www.example.com时,会将请求转发到本地的8080端口。
这样,通过访问www.example.com就相当于访问了本地的8080端口。

配置完成后,需要重启Nginx使配置生效。此时,当用户通过域名访问服务器时,就会将请求映射到指定的端口上,
实现了域名与端口的关联。

值得注意的是,域名映射端口需要保证服务器上相应的端口已经在运行对应的服务。否则,无法正常访问服务器上的服务。

总而言之,通过配置反向代理服务器,我们可以实现域名与端口的映射,使得通过域名访问服务器上的特定服务成为可能。

0
没有账号?注册  忘记密码?